共用方式為


TSqlModelOptions 類別

定義

定義模型的各種選項

public sealed class TSqlModelOptions
type TSqlModelOptions = class
Public NotInheritable Class TSqlModelOptions
繼承
TSqlModelOptions

建構函式

TSqlModelOptions()

建構 TSqlModelOptions

屬性

AllowSnapshotIsolation

指定 ALLOW_SNAPSHOT_ISOLATION 資料庫選項。

AnsiNullDefaultOn

指定 ANSI_NULL_DEFAULT 資料庫選項。

AnsiNullsOn

指定 ANSI_NULLS 資料庫選項。

AnsiPaddingOn

指定 ANSI_PADDING 資料庫選項。

AnsiWarningsOn

指定 ANSI_WARNINGS 資料庫選項。

ArithAbortOn

指定 ARITH_ABORT 資料庫選項。

AutoClose

指定 AUTO_CLOSE 資料庫選項。

AutoCreateStatistics

指定 AUTO_CREATE_STATISTICS 資料庫選項。

AutoCreateStatisticsIncremental

指定 AUTO_CREATE_STATISTICS INCREMENTAL 資料庫選項。

AutoShrink

指定 AUTO_SHRINK 資料庫選項。

AutoUpdateStatistics

指定 AUTO_UPDATE_STATISTICS 資料庫選項。

AutoUpdateStatisticsAsync

指定 AUTO_UPDATE_STATISTICS_ASYNC 資料庫選項。

CatalogCollation

指定CATALOG_COLLATION_TYPE資料庫選項

ChangeTrackingAutoCleanup

指定 AUTO_CLEANUP 資料庫選項。

ChangeTrackingEnabled

指定了 CHANGE_TRACKING 資料庫選項。

ChangeTrackingRetentionPeriod

指定 CHANGE_RETENTION 資料庫選項的期間。

ChangeTrackingRetentionUnit

指定 CHANGE_RETENTION 資料庫選項的單位。

Collation

指定要用於模型的定序。 這是必須為有效 SQL Server 定序名稱的字串,例如 "SQL_Latin1_General_CP1_CI_AS"

CompatibilityLevel

指定 COMPATIBILITY_LEVEL 資料庫選項。

ConcatNullYieldsNull

指定 CONCAT_NULL_YIELDS_NULL 資料庫選項。

Containment

指定 CONTAINMENT 資料庫選項。

CursorCloseOnCommit

指定 CURSOR_CLOSE_ON_COMMIT 資料庫選項。

CursorDefaultGlobalScope

指定 CURSOR_DEFAULT 資料庫選項。

DatabaseStateOffline

指定 ONLINE | OFFLINE 資料庫選項。

DataRetentionEnabled

指定 [資料保留資料庫] 選項。 目前僅針對 Edge 啟用

DateCorrelationOptimizationOn

指定 DATE_CORRELATION_OPTIMIZATION 資料庫選項。

DBChainingOn

指定 DB_CHAINING 資料庫選項。

DbScopedConfigDWCompatibilityLevel

指定資料庫範圍設定 DWCompatibilityLevel 選項。

DbScopedConfigLegacyCardinalityEstimation

指定 [資料庫範圍設定] LEGACY_CARDINALITY_ESTIMATION選項。

DbScopedConfigLegacyCardinalityEstimationSecondary

指定次要資料庫的資料庫範圍組態LEGACY_CARDINALITY_ESTIMATION選項。

DbScopedConfigMaxDOP

指定 [資料庫範圍設定 MAXDOP] 選項。

DbScopedConfigMaxDOPSecondary

指定次要資料庫的資料庫範圍設定 MAXDOP 選項。

DbScopedConfigParameterSniffing

指定 [資料庫範圍設定PARAMETER_SNIFFING] 選項。

DbScopedConfigParameterSniffingSecondary

指定次要資料庫的資料庫範圍設定PARAMETER_SNIFFING選項。

DbScopedConfigQueryOptimizerHotfixes

指定 [資料庫範圍設定] QUERY_OPTIMIZER_HOTFIXES選項。

DbScopedConfigQueryOptimizerHotfixesSecondary

指定次要資料庫的資料庫範圍組態QUERY_OPTIMIZER_HOTFIXES選項。

DefaultFullTextLanguage

指定 DEFAULT_FULLTEXT_LANGUAGE 資料庫選項。

DefaultLanguage

指定 DEFAULT_LANGUAGE 資料庫選項。

DelayedDurabilityMode

指定 DELAYED_DURABILITY 資料庫選項。

EngineVersion

指定應該由模型指定為目標的引擎版本。 對於內部部署平台,將忽略此值,因為引擎版本是根據的平台而固定。 針對 SqlAzure 平台,將會設定這個值,並用來指定支援的 T-SQL 語言功能。

FileStreamDirectoryName

指定 DIRECTORY_NAME 資料庫選項。

FullTextEnabled

指定 sp_fulltext_database 資料庫選項。

HonorBrokerPriority

指定 HONOR_BROKER_PRIORITY 資料庫選項。

MemoryOptimizedElevateToSnapshot

指定 MEMORY_OPTIMIZED_ELEVATE_TO_SNAPSHOT 資料庫選項。

NestedTriggersOn

指定 NESTED_TRIGGER 資料庫選項。

NonTransactedFileStreamAccess

指定 NON_TRANSACTED_ACCESS 資料庫選項。

NumericRoundAbortOn

指定 NUMERIC_ROUNDABORT 資料庫選項。

PageVerifyMode

指定 PAGE_VERIFY 資料庫選項。

ParameterizationOption

指定 PARAMETERIZATION 資料庫選項。

QueryStoreCaptureMode

指定QUERY_STORE資料庫選項的查詢擷取模式。

QueryStoreDesiredState

指定QUERY_STORE資料庫選項的作業模式。

QueryStoreFlushInterval

指定QUERY_STORE資料庫選項的Flush_Interval_Seconds設定。

QueryStoreIntervalLength

指定QUERY_STORE資料庫選項的Interval_Length_Minutes設定。

QueryStoreMaxPlansPerQuery

指定QUERY_STORE資料庫選項的Max_Plans_Per_Query設定。

QueryStoreMaxStorageSize

指定QUERY_STORE資料庫選項的Max_Storage_Size_MB設定。

QueryStoreStaleQueryThreshold

指定QUERY_STORE資料庫選項的Stale_Query_Threshold_Days設定。

QuotedIdentifierOn

指定 QUOTED_IDENTIFIER 資料庫選項。

ReadOnly

指定 READ_ONLY | READ_WRITE 資料庫選項。

RecoveryMode

指定 RECOVERY 資料庫選項。

RecursiveTriggersOn

指定 RECURSIVE_TRIGGERS 資料庫選項。

ServiceBrokerOption

指定 ENABLE_BROKER | DISABLE_BROKER | NEW_BROKER | ERROR_BROKER_CONVERSATIONS 資料庫選項。

StorageType

指定儲存體類型 - 記憶體中或支援的檔案。 預設值是 Memory

SupplementalLoggingOn

指定 SUPPLEMENTAL_LOGGING 資料庫選項。

TargetRecoveryTimePeriod

指定 TARGET_RECOVERY_TIME 資料庫選項的期間。

TargetRecoveryTimeUnit

指定 TARGET_RECOVERY_TIME 資料庫選項的單位。

TornPageProtectionOn

指定 TORN_PAGE_DETECTION 資料庫選項。

TransactionIsolationReadCommittedSnapshot

指定 READ_COMMITTED_SNAPSHOT 資料庫選項。

TransformNoiseWords

指定 TRANSFORM_NOISE_WORDS 資料庫選項。

Trustworthy

指定 TRUSTWORTHY 資料庫選項。

TwoDigitYearCutoff

指定 TWO_DIGIT_YEAR_CUTOFF 資料庫選項。

UserAccessOption

指定 SINGLE_USER | RESTRICTED_USER | MULTI_USER 資料庫選項。

VardecimalStorageFormatOn

指定 sp_db_vardecimal_storage_format 資料庫選項。

WithEncryption

指定 ENCRYPTION 資料庫選項。

適用於